Hoewel softwareontwikkeling niet rechtstreeks leidt tot een traditionele technische graad, kan het absoluut een opstap zijn voor een carrière in engineering, en zelfs een sterke basis bieden voor het nastreven van een. Hier is hoe:
Directe paden:
* Computertechniek: Softwareontwikkelingsvaardigheden zijn zeer waardevol in computertechniek, die zich richt op hardware-software-integratie. Veel softwareontwikkelaars gaan over naar rollen met ingebedde systemen, hardware -interfaces of firmware -ontwikkeling.
* Software Engineering: Softwareontwikkeling is vaak het startpunt voor een carrière in software -engineering. Naarmate u ervaring en kennis opdoet, kunt u overstappen in meer gespecialiseerde rollen zoals systeemarchitectuur, ontwerp of testen.
Indirecte paden:
* vaardighedenoverdracht: Softwareontwikkeling ontwikkelt cruciale probleemoplossende, analytische en logische denkvaardigheden, die op alle technische velden zeer waardevol zijn. Deze kennis kan worden gebruikt in velden zoals:
* Werktuigbouwkunde: Programmeervaardigheden kunnen worden gebruikt voor simulaties, automatisering en besturingssystemen.
* Elektrotechniek: Ervaring met softwareontwikkeling kan waardevol zijn voor embedded systemen, circuitontwerp en communicatiesystemen.
* Civiele techniek: Software wordt in toenemende mate gebruikt voor structurele analyse, ontwerp en projectmanagement.
* Opleiding: Ervaring met softwareontwikkeling kan een sterk aanwinst zijn bij het aanvragen van engineeringprogramma's. Veel universiteiten erkennen de waarde van relevante werkervaring.
Overwegingen:
* Formeel onderwijs: Als u een formele technische graad wilt volgen, moet u waarschijnlijk extra cursussen in specifieke technische disciplines voltooien.
* focus: Softwareontwikkeling benadrukt probleemoplossing door codering, terwijl engineering een breder begrip van fysieke principes en ontwerpbeperkingen inhoudt.
* Carrièrepad: Zowel softwareontwikkeling als engineering bieden diverse en lonende carrièrepaden, maar ze hebben verschillende focus.
Tot slot kan softwareontwikkeling een toegangspoort zijn tot een carrière in engineering. Het rust je uit met waardevolle vaardigheden en ervaring, waardoor je mogelijk op weg is naar een formeel engineeringonderwijs of een rol in een gerelateerd veld. |